Cristiano Ronaldo Net Worth in 2026 (Estimated)

Estimated Net Worth: $850 Million – $1 Billion (2026)

Ronaldo remains one of the highest-paid athletes globally. His wealth has been built through:

  • Professional football contracts

  • Major endorsement deals

  • Personal brand businesses

  • Investments & real estate

  • Social media influence

With consistent high earnings over two decades, his net worth continues to grow even late in his playing career.

Cristiano Ronaldo Salary in 2026

Ronaldo’s move to Saudi Arabian club Al Nassr FC dramatically increased his annual earnings.

Estimated Annual Club Salary:

$200 Million per year (including bonuses and commercial agreements)

This makes him one of the highest-paid footballers in history.

His contract reportedly includes:

  • Base salary

  • Performance bonuses

  • Commercial rights agreements

  • Promotional incentives

How Much Does Cristiano Ronaldo Make Per Year?

Combining all major income streams:

Income SourceEstimated Annual Earnings
Club Salary~$200 Million
Endorsements~$40–60 Million
Business Profits~$20–40 Million
Total Annual Earnings~$260–300+ Million

This explains how his net worth approaches the billion-dollar mark.

Is Cristiano Ronaldo a billionaire in 2026?

While exact figures are private, financial estimates place his net worth between $850 million and $1 billion, meaning he is approaching billionaire status.

How much does Cristiano Ronaldo earn per day?

Based on estimated annual earnings of $260–300 million, Ronaldo may earn approximately $700,000–$820,000 per day.

What is Cristiano Ronaldo’s salary at Al Nassr?

His contract with Al Nassr is reportedly worth around $200 million per year, including commercial agreements.

What are Ronaldo’s biggest endorsement deals?

His lifetime partnership with Nike remains one of the most valuable deals in sports marketing history.
